Le Male Elixir Perfume Quality Control Report
This comprehensive inspection covers Jean Paul Gaultier's Le Male Elixir fragrance, focusing on authenticity markers, packaging integrity, and product quality. As a premium designer fragrance, attention to detail is crucial for verifying genuine items versus potential replicas.
Packaging Inspection
The outer packaging should exhibit high-quality printing with crisp, clear text and logos. The iconic Jean Paul Gaultier sailor torso design should be perfectly centered with vibrant, consistent colors. Check for:
- Precise embossing on the box surface
- Sharp, clean edges without fraying
- Correct font usage and spacing on all text
- Proper holographic or security stickers if present
Bottle & Components
The signature sailor bottle must be examined thoroughly. The glass should be flawless without bubbles, scratches, or imperfections. The metal components (cap, collar) should have:
- Even plating without discoloration
- Smooth, precise threading for cap attachment
- Clear, deeply engraved logos and text
- Proper weight and heft (authentic bottles feel substantial)
Batch Code & Authenticity
Locate the batch code (typically on bottom of bottle or box) and verify it corresponds to production dates. Check for consistency between box and bottle codes. Authentic items will have:
- Cleanly printed or laser-etched codes
- Logical date sequencing
- No signs of tampering or code alteration
Sprayer & Performance
The atomizer should function smoothly with consistent mist distribution. Test spray (if possible) to ensure proper operation. The fragrance should dispense evenly without leaking or sticking.
